Key responsibilities include:
Business & Process Analysis
- Lead requirements elicitation activities, including stakeholder interviews, workshops, and process walkthroughs.
- Analyse and document end-to-end business processes (AS-IS and TO-BE), identifying opportunities for optimisation, standardisation, and digital enablement.
- Translate business needs into clear, structured requirements, user stories, and functional specifications.
- Support solution design by collaborating with architects, product owners, and delivery teams.
Digital & Transformation Delivery
- Contribute to enterprise and domain-level digital transformation initiatives, ensuring alignment to strategic objectives and business outcomes.
- Develop and maintain transformation playbooks, including delivery standards, artefacts, governance models, and reusable accelerators.
- Assist with benefits definition, baseline establishment, and benefits realisation tracking.
Domain-Focused Delivery
- Help scope Sales and Compensation solutions.
- Support transformation across field services, including workforce management, scheduling, mobility, and service execution.
- Enable improvements within service centres / contact centres, including case management, customer journeys, and omnichannel service models.
- Contribute to initiatives involving assets and inventory, including lifecycle management, stock optimisation, and visibility.
